Technical Game Designer

Work from home Full-time role Hiring

Beef Noodle Studios is looking for an experienced Technical Game Designer to prototype, design, and implement various game systems, features, and content in our endless story generating colony sim. The ideal candidate has deep game design experience as well as game engineering experience. This role is expected to be able to lead design processes, paper prototype, prototype in engine, and work with our engineering team to implement production game logic. Candidates must excel at communication, prioritization, developing feature specifications, implementing game features quickly, and knowing when to cut features. This is a fully-remote contractor position, with the opportunity to convert to an employee after 3 months. Prerequisites

Current Game Project We are making an accessible colony sim with a strong emphasis on setting and storytelling. While many games in the colony sim genre lean into giving the player lots of powerful management tools and a complex user interface, we are instead pursuing a more delightfully simple approach that allows newcomers to the genre to immediately pick up and play. For our setting, we’ve chosen a whimsical woodland filled with cute critters, think “Rimworld meets Redwall.”
